Shirley Brady

January 10, 1932 - January 19, 2022

Shirley JoAnn Brady was a caring wife, mother, grandmother, great grandmother, sister, daughter and friend. She left this world peacefully at her home on January 19, 2022 at the age of 90. She was born to Ralph and Kathryn (Lippert) Borchers on January 10, 1932 and was raised on the family farm in Wallingford, Iowa. After graduating from high school she attended Iowa Lutheran Nursing School. Her career as a Registered Nurse reached from Iowa to Texas and gave her a lifetime of fulfilment and purpose. Shirley met the love of her life, Robert Brady in high school and they were married in Kansas City in 1955. There they raised their family and she was devoted to all aspects of her children’s lives. She gave generously of her time and commitment to her family, friends, organizations and community. When Bob’s career brought them to Texas in 1978 she again built a foundation of home and family where she treasured time with her grandchildren and great grandchildren. As a member of Concordia Lutheran Church in Bedford, Texas she found fellowship and friends that supported her faithfully. Shirley was happiest in the garden tending to her flowers, finding joy in every bloom. She loved activities at the Bedford Senior Center and spent many hours dancing, making ceramics, playing dominos and shouting Bingo. Shirley would proudly tell you that she had a BLESSED life.
